Commerce Secretary Howard Lutnick touted the Trump administration’s “monster” commerce cope with the European Union (EU) as a historic second for the American individuals.
Lutnick joined “Particular Report” Monday after President Donald Trump and EU Fee President Ursula von der Leyen introduced a deal in Scotland forward of a looming Aug. 1 tariff deadline that threatened to upend international commerce.
“They agreed for the primary time ever to chop all their tariffs, reduce their obstacles and let American companies and farmers and ranchers and fishermen, lastly, promote into the European Union,” Lutnick stated. “Huge market. That is big for America.”

The White Home stated the EU pays a 15% tariff, together with on autos, auto components, prescription drugs and semiconductors, in addition to a 50% tariff on metal, aluminum and copper.
It can additionally, amongst different issues, make investments roughly $600 billion in the US over the subsequent three years and buy $750 billion of U.S. vitality exports by means of 2028, a transfer geared toward lowering Europe’s reliance on Russian vitality.
“President Trump’s settlement with the European Union achieves historic structural reforms and strategic commitments that can profit American trade, staff, and nationwide safety for generations,” learn a press release from the White Home partially.

EU Commerce Commissioner Maros Sefcovic defended the commerce deal amid criticism from France’s Commerce Minister Laurent Saint-Martin and France’s Prime Minister François Bayrou, who each prompt it was unbalanced.

“That is clearly the perfect deal we may get beneath very tough circumstances,” Sefcovic stated at a press convention Monday in Brussels.
He added that he’s satisfied the deal saves commerce, commerce flows and jobs in Europe and “opens [a] new chapter in EU-US relations [on] the best way to modify our mutual buying and selling patterns on this new age of geoeconomics and geopolitics.”

Lutnick advised Fox Information chief political anchor Bret Baier the deal is useful for each the U.S. and the EU as a result of the 2 can develop their companies collectively.
“Lastly, we have righted the improper of commerce and Donald Trump has led the best way,” stated Lutnick.
The commerce secretary prompt extra offers might be completed earlier than Friday however defined that Trump may additionally simply set tariff charges for different international locations.
“By the top of this week, they’ll all be set. They may all be in stone, and they are going to be written, and we’ll begin accumulating these extra monies,” he advised “Particular Report.” “Proper now, we’re accumulating 10% from everyone on the planet, and naturally, a greater charge from China. However come subsequent week, off we go.”
